A written agreement becomes legal when it includes essential components such as an offer, acceptance, and consideration. Both parties must sign the agreement, demonstrating their consent. Furthermore, the agreement should not violate any laws or public policies. Using a reputable service like US Legal Forms can help you draft an agreement that meets all these legal standards.

The format of writing an agreement typically includes a title, preamble, and body. Start with a title that reflects the nature of the agreement, followed by date and parties' information. The body should clearly delineate the terms of agreement, incorporating sections for obligations and signatures. A systematic format helps in maintaining clarity and is vital for legal acknowledgment.

To write out an agreement, begin with a draft that includes the title, date, and full names of the parties involved. Next, list the key terms, including the responsibilities, compensation, and duration. After drafting, review the document for clarity and completeness to ensure that it reflects the intentions of all parties.
